Why Does a 1 TB Hard Drive Show as 931 GB in Windows?

Storage makers rate 1 TB as 1,000,000,000,000 Bytes (base 1000). Windows calculates capacities using base 1024 (1,000,000,000,000 ÷ 1024³ = 931.32 GiB), producing the apparent discrepancy without any actual lost capacity.

Digital Storage & Data Converter Complete Guide

Understanding digital storage units—Bits, Bytes, KB, MB, GB, TB, and PB—is essential for managing files, server hosting, and bandwidth.

Storage manufacturers use base 1000 (1 TB = 1,000,000,000,000 Bytes), whereas operating systems like Windows calculate using base 1024 (GiB), explaining why a 1 TB SSD reads as 931 GB.

Expert Tips & Best Practices
  • To find real-world download speed in MB/s, divide your ISP speed in Mbps by 8.
  • A 50 GB 4K movie takes roughly 7 minutes on a 1 Gbps fiber connection.

How many MB are in 1 GB?

In binary computing (Windows), 1 GB = 1,024 MB. In decimal metric standards, 1 GB = 1,000 MB.

What is the difference between a Bit and a Byte?

1 Byte (B) equals 8 Bits (b). Network bandwidth is rated in bits (e.g. 100 Mbps), while file sizes use Bytes (MB/GB).
